## Thumbnail Queue — Restart Procedure

The Glimmerbox thumbnail workers occasionally stall when source images exceed 80 MB. Check the stuck-job count in the dashboard first; if it's above 50, drain and restart the worker pool with `glim restart --pool thumbs`. Before restarting, verify queue depth directly against the jobs database using the connection string below.

warehouse DSN: mssql://rusdor_svc:0FSWCn9@db-951a.paliqforge.local:5432/ulawyn

# Client setup for the Grindlewash queue consumer.
# Heads up, future maintainers: Grindlewash runs log compaction every
# six hours, so any consumer that lags past the compaction horizon
# will see gaps — that's expected, not data loss. Keep your offsets
# committed or you'll chase phantom bugs like we did in March.
# The client needs to auth against the Grindlewash broker before
# subscribing. The broker's internal service key goes right below.

gateway credential: kto7_GoY89Me

Subject: Key-card stock for the Norbridge site

Dispatch team,

The blank key-card stock for the new Norbridge site is boxed and sealed in the secure cabinet by my desk. There are four boxes, each shrink-wrapped and numbered. These must travel together in a single consignment and cannot be left unattended at any point during transit. Collection is booked with Stellhaven Secure Logistics for Thursday morning. Please verify the courier's credentials on arrival and log the collection time. The confidential hand-over instruction is stated below.

courier memo of tawep-tajep: the quenius ulaiel courier leaves the fenir ledger at gate 9128 under passcode 527513

## Migration Step 4: Audio-Guide Content Tables

The Lanterhall museum guide app is moving its exhibit narration metadata from flat JSON files into the new content database. Run the `guide-migrate` tool against a staging copy first and verify that every stop ID maps to exactly one narration track per language. Once counts match, you can perform the production import by pointing the tool at the connection string below.

database URL for bagap-yahap: mysql://druax_svc:s0i8rHw@db-fdc1.orvexworks.local:5432/druius